A small PR that allows the user selectable leniency of minimum temperature for LUT violation. Put the following in AGCM.rc:
RRTMGP_LW_TMIN_INC_OK_K: 15.0
RRTMGP_SW_TMIN_INC_OK_K: 15.0
Here 15.0 is an example. The default for both is 10.0 Kelvin. 15.0 is more lenient than 10.0.
This change is non-zero-diff, but only if you are running RRTMGP.
